Global Automotive Sparking Cable Market (USD Million), 2021 - 2031
In the year 2024, the Global Automotive Sparking Cable Market was valued at USD 4,427.72 million. The size of this market is expected to increase to USD 6,025.52 million by the year 2031, while growing at a Compounded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 4.5%.
The global automotive sparking cable market is a crucial segment within the broader automotive industry, primarily responsible for transmitting high-voltage electricity from the ignition coil to the spark plugs in internal combustion engines. Sparking cables play a pivotal role in ensuring efficient ignition and combustion processes, thereby directly impacting engine performance, fuel efficiency, and emissions. As automotive technology advances, the demand for high-quality sparking cables that can withstand increased temperatures, voltage loads, and environmental conditions continues to grow.
Key drivers influencing the automotive sparking cable market include stringent emission regulations worldwide, which necessitate the development of more efficient and cleaner combustion engines. Manufacturers are increasingly focusing on designing sparking cables that offer superior conductivity, durability, and resistance to electrical interference. Moreover, the growing adoption of electric vehicles (EVs) and hybrid electric vehicles (HEVs) has spurred innovations in sparking cable technology to meet the unique requirements of these alternative propulsion systems.

Global Automotive Sparking Cable Market, Segmentation by Cables Type
The Global Automotive Sparking Cable Market has been segmented by Cables Type into Magnetic Resistance Cables, Distributes Resistance Cables, Fixed Resistor Cables and Others.
Magnetic resistance cables represent a significant segment within the global automotive sparking cable market. These cables are designed to minimize electromagnetic interference (EMI) while efficiently transmitting high-voltage electricity from the ignition coil to the spark plugs. They are constructed using materials that offer high conductivity and are resistant to heat and environmental factors. Magnetic resistance cables are preferred in automotive applications where maintaining a stable electrical connection is crucial for engine performance and fuel efficiency. Their robust design helps in reducing electrical noise and ensuring reliable ignition timing, contributing to overall vehicle reliability and performance.
Distributed resistance cables are another key segment in the market. Unlike magnetic resistance cables, which focus on reducing EMI, distributed resistance cables are engineered to evenly distribute electrical resistance along their length. This feature helps in optimizing the spark energy delivered to each spark plug, thereby enhancing combustion efficiency and reducing emissions. Distributed resistance cables are designed with specific resistance levels tailored to the requirements of different automotive engines, ensuring consistent performance across various operating conditions. They play a vital role in modern engine management systems by supporting precise ignition timing and enhancing overall engine power and responsiveness.
Fixed resistor cables constitute a specialized segment within the automotive sparking cable market. These cables integrate resistors directly into the cable assembly, typically near the spark plug end. The resistors are strategically placed to suppress electrical noise and prevent interference with electronic components within the vehicle. Fixed resistor cables offer enhanced reliability and durability, making them suitable for demanding automotive environments. They contribute to improved engine performance by ensuring stable ignition and reducing the risk of misfires, thereby extending the lifespan of ignition components. Fixed resistor cables are favored in vehicles equipped with advanced ignition systems, where maintaining optimal electrical conditions is critical for achieving efficient combustion and complying with emissions standards.

Limited innovation in materials- The global automotive sparking cable market is currently experiencing limited innovation in materials, posing challenges and opportunities for industry players. Sparking cables, crucial components in internal combustion engines, transmit electrical energy to the spark plugs, igniting the air-fuel mixture. Traditionally, these cables have been made from materials such as copper or other conductive metals due to their excellent electrical conductivity and reliability. However, the automotive industry's shift towards electrification and sustainability has placed pressure on manufacturers to explore alternative materials that offer improved performance and environmental benefits.
Despite advancements in automotive technology, sparking cable innovation has been relatively stagnant concerning material composition. Copper remains predominant due to its superior electrical conductivity, thermal stability, and durability, meeting industry standards effectively. Alternative materials such as aluminum alloys or even carbon fibers have been considered for their lighter weight and potentially lower production costs. However, challenges like reduced conductivity compared to copper and compatibility issues with existing engine designs have hindered widespread adoption.

Integration of advanced materials- The global automotive sparking cable market is witnessing significant evolution driven by the integration of advanced materials. Sparking cables, crucial components in internal combustion engines, are undergoing a transformation to meet the demands of modern automotive technology. One of the key trends shaping this market is the shift towards advanced materials that offer superior performance characteristics such as enhanced durability, improved conductivity, and reduced electromagnetic interference. Materials like silicone, EPDM (Ethylene Propylene Diene Monomer), and other high-performance polymers are replacing traditional materials like rubber and PVC due to their ability to withstand higher temperatures and harsh operating conditions.
